What is the Slope of A(-6,2) and B(5,-1) ?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 13-04-2018
Slope formula: [tex] \fr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1} [/tex]
Apply.
[tex] \frac{-1 - 2}{5 - (-6)} = -\frac{3}{11} = slope[/tex]
